成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

阿里在線前端筆試題

開發 前端
參加了2015年暑假實習校園招聘,好吧,其實就看看題目長什么樣字、廢話不多說,上題。

本人大三,非985,211。

參加了2015年暑假實習校園招聘,好吧,其實就看看題目長什么樣字、廢話不多說,上題。

[[131314]]

一共13題,6個選擇,1題是github地址或博客微博地址,6個大題。

選擇題***題:

  1. var arr = [1,2,3,4,5]; 
  2. arr.splice(1,2,3,4,5); 
  3. arr? 

考察數組splice的用法。

后面幾個選擇題忘了(別打臉),選擇題都不是很難。

大題:

1.考查css的基本知識,給出html基本代碼。寫css代碼, 每個div是一個盒子模型。中間文字水平垂直居中,三個盒子水平排列。(比較基礎,代碼就不上了)

2.多維數組轉一位數組:原題:[1,[2,3]] ==》 [1,2,3]

  1. var arr = [1,[[4,5,6],2,[[[7,8,9]]],3]]; //轉成一位數組:[1, 4, 5, 6, 2, 7, 8, 9, 3] 
  2. function f(arr){ 
  3.     if(Object.prototype.toString.call(arr) != '[object Array]')  //判斷arr是不是數組 
  4.         return
  5.     var newArr = []; 
  6.     function fn(arr){  
  7.         for (var i = 0; i < arr.length; i++) {//遍歷數組 
  8.             if(arr[i].length){//判斷是不是多維數組 
  9.                 fn(arr[i]);    //遞歸調用 
  10.             }else
  11.                 newArr.push(arr[i]); 
  12.             } 
  13.         } 
  14.     } 
  15.     fn(arr); 
  16.     return newArr; 
  17. console.log(f(arr)); 
當時在做試卷的時候 沒有考慮多維數組,只片面的為了解題,沒有用遞歸。

3.數字類型轉千分位表示

  1. var num = 123456789.9//結果轉成千分位表示 123,456,789.9 
  2. function f(num){ 
  3.     if(typeof num != 'number'
  4.         return
  5.     num += ''
  6.     if(num.indexOf('.')!=-1){ //判斷是否存在小數 
  7.         return fn(num.split('.')[0])+'.'+num.split('.')[1]; 
  8.     }else
  9.         return fn(num); 
  10.     } 
  11.     function fn(newNum){ 
  12.         var str = ''
  13.         var l = newNum.length; 
  14.         while(l>3){ 
  15.             str = ','+newNum.substring(l-3,l) + str; 
  16.             l = l-3
  17.         } 
  18.         str = newNum.substring(0,l) + str; 
  19.         return str; 
  20.     } 
  21. console.log(f(num)); 

4.解析url:var str = 'http://s.weibo.com/weibo/Aralic?topnav=1&wvr=6'獲得參數名和參數值:

(以前做過類似的題目,解析url一系列的值,阿里這題感覺稍微簡單一點)

  1. function f(url){ 
  2.     var l = url.indexOf('?'); 
  3.     if(l!=-1){ 
  4.         var obj = {}; 
  5.         var arr = url.substring(l+1,url.length).split('&'); 
  6.         for(var i = 0; i<arr.length; i++){ 
  7.             obj[arr[i].split('=')[0]] = arr[i].split('=')[1]; 
  8.         } 
  9.         return obj; 
  10.     } 
  11. console.log(f('http://s.weibo.com/weibo/Aralic?topnav=1&wvr=6')) 

有幸看到的園子大牛幫忙給點意見,不是專門學計算機的,算法比較差。

責任編輯:王雪燕 來源: 尋醫問藥網
相關推薦

2009-02-27 10:46:32

DBA筆試題阿里巴巴

2009-06-15 17:18:25

Java筆試題

2010-08-11 11:57:02

微軟筆試題微軟筆試題

2010-08-11 12:07:08

騰訊筆試題騰訊筆試題

2009-07-28 13:35:18

2010-08-11 11:22:00

IBM筆試題IBM筆試

2010-08-11 11:32:57

谷歌筆試題谷歌筆試題

2020-06-01 08:39:12

JavaScript開發技術

2010-08-16 15:27:22

雅虎筆試題

2010-08-18 10:17:00

2012-06-28 14:35:49

Web

2015-06-09 14:43:36

javascript操作字符串

2018-01-02 09:23:38

數據分析算法阿里巴巴

2016-12-16 12:32:50

阿里數據分析職業要求

2021-04-28 08:03:15

HIVESQLlead

2009-07-14 10:05:02

HCDA認證考試筆試題

2010-08-18 10:27:56

2010-08-31 23:15:42

IT筆試題企業

2011-08-11 17:39:25

Objective-C筆試題

2020-07-14 16:08:33

數據分析Python筆試
點贊
收藏

51CTO技術棧公眾號

主站蜘蛛池模板: 成人亚洲 | 国产精品夜间视频香蕉 | 国产精品久久久久久一区二区三区 | 国产亚洲欧美在线视频 | 国产精品久久九九 | 亚洲视频在线观看 | 天天草天天干 | 91大片| 午夜视频一区 | 免费观看一级特黄欧美大片 | 狠狠躁天天躁夜夜躁婷婷老牛影视 | 久久男人| 日韩久久久久久 | 久久伦理中文字幕 | 99在线免费观看 | 精品国产一区二区三区观看不卡 | 成人在线小视频 | 日韩中文字幕在线视频 | 精品免费国产一区二区三区四区 | 日日夜夜天天 | 久久久国产一区二区三区 | 在线欧美一区 | 免费看a| 国产一区免费 | 日本涩涩视频 | 91在线免费观看网站 | 日韩一区精品 | 国产一区二区三区四区 | 91精品国产色综合久久 | 伊人激情网 | 狠狠草视频 | 国产精品日韩一区 | 91国内产香蕉 | 午夜免费观看体验区 | 国产精品一区二区不卡 | 欧美美乳 | 91精品麻豆日日躁夜夜躁 | julia中文字幕久久一区二区 | 超碰最新在线 | 国产激情一区二区三区 | 欧美日在线 |